Reducing Opioid Misuse: Evaluation of a Medicaid Controlled Substance Lock-In Program

Medicaid Lock-In Programs (MLIPs) significantly reduced opioid prescriptions and associated costs for patients in North Carolina. While effective in curbing overutilization, careful consideration is needed to ensure legitimate patient access to pain medication.
Area of Science:
- Public Health
- Health Policy
- Pharmacoeconomics
Background:
- Opioid misuse, abuse, and overdose represent a critical public health crisis.
- Medicaid Lock-In Programs (MLIPs) are implemented to curb overutilization of controlled substances among Medicaid beneficiaries.
- Limited data exists on the real-world impact of MLIPs on patient prescribing patterns and healthcare expenditures.
Purpose of the Study:
- To evaluate the effect of North Carolina's MLIP on Medicaid-reimbursed opioid prescriptions.
- To analyze changes in opioid utilization metrics, including claims, pharmacy use, supply duration, units, and costs, following MLIP enrollment.
- To assess the efficacy of MLIPs as a strategy to mitigate the opioid epidemic.
Main Methods:
- Utilized North Carolina Medicaid claims data spanning October 2008 to June 2013.
- Employed mixed-effects models to analyze the impact of MLIP enrollment on monthly opioid-related outcomes.
- Examined data for 6,148 patients enrolled in the MLIP.
Main Results:
- MLIP enrollment was associated with an 84% reduction in the odds of having any opioid claim per month (OR = 0.16).
- Significant decreases observed in monthly opioid prescriptions (-1.13), number of pharmacies used (-0.61), and Medicaid expenditures for opioids (-$22.78).
- The program demonstrated a substantial impact on reducing opioid prescription frequency and associated costs.
Conclusions:
- MLIPs appear to be a successful component in comprehensive strategies to reduce potential opioid overutilization.
- The findings suggest MLIPs can effectively decrease prescription opioid misuse, abuse, and diversion.
- Further research is warranted to investigate potential unintended consequences and ensure patient access to necessary pain management.
